Designing the architecture and software components of the dockerised blockchain mediator

Вантажиться...
Ескіз

Дата

Науковий ступінь

Рівень дисертації

Шифр та назва спеціальності

Рада захисту

Установа захисту

Науковий керівник/консультант

Члени комітету

Назва журналу

Номер ISSN

Назва тому

Видавець

Національний технічний університет "Харківський політехнічний інститут"

Анотація

Small and medium enterprises are not adopting blockchain solutions in their supply chains and business processes due to the cost of implementing and deploying the solutions. The architecture, which is described, is aimed at lowering the barrier for smaller-scale businesses to adopt distributed technologies in their supply chains. Docker’s containerization capabilities are leveraged to achieve these goals due to improved horizontal scaling and providing a unified environment for the application deployment. This architecture leverages tools provided by the Docker to design scalable and robust system that is easily maintainable. Some of the key challenges are addressed by the proposed architecture, such as high development costs, incompatibility with existing systems, and complicated setup processes, which are required for every participant in the supply chain. This research describes how utilizing Docker system capabilities can help enable smaller-scale businesses to adapt distributed solutions in their supply chains and cooperation with other companies by tackling the issues of traceability, transparency, and trust. The main components of the architecture are a mediator server containerized within a Docker network, a blockchain node, and an NGINX proxy server container. Малі та середні підприємства не впроваджують блокчейн-рішення у свої ланцюги постачання та бізнес-процеси через високу вартість їх впровадження та розгортання. Описана архітектура спрямована на зниження бар'єрів для малих підприємств у впровадженні розподілених технологій у свої ланцюги постачання. Для досягнення цих цілей використовуються можливості контейнеризації Docker завдяки покращеному горизонтальному масштабуванню та забезпеченню єдиного середовища для розгортання додатків. Ця архітектура використовує інструменти, надані Docker, для проектування масштабованої та надійної системи, яка легко підтримується. Пропонована архітектура вирішує деякі ключові проблеми, такі як високі витрати на розробку, несумісність з існуючими системами та складні процеси налаштування, які необхідні для кожного учасника ланцюга постачання. У цьому дослідженні описано, як використання можливостей системи Docker може допомогти малим підприємствам адаптувати розподілені рішення у своїх ланцюгах постачання та співпраці з іншими компаніями шляхом вирішення проблем простежуваності, прозорості та довіри. Основними компонентами архітектури є контейнерний сервер-посередник у мережі Docker, вузол блокчейну та контейнерний проксі-сервер NGINX.

Опис

Бібліографічний опис

Zherzherunov P. Y. Designing the architecture and software components of the dockerised blockchain mediator / P. Y. Zherzherunov, O. V. Shmatko // Вісник Національного технічного університету "ХПІ". Серія: Системний аналіз, управління та інформаційні технології = Bulletin of the National Technical University "KhPI". Series: System analysis, control and information technology : зб. наук. пр. – Харків : НТУ "ХПІ", 2025. – № 1 (13). – С. 101-105.

Підтвердження

Рецензія

Додано до

Згадується в